21xrx.com
2024-12-22 21:31:00 Sunday
登录
文章检索 我的文章 写文章
C++中的类名命名规则详解
2023-07-05 07:52:44 深夜i     --     --
C++类名 命名规则 常见命名方法 类名与文件名的对应关系 错误的类名命名方

在C++编程中,类名命名规则是一项非常重要的技能。遵循这些规则可以让你的代码更清晰易懂,并且能够帮助你在团队开发中更好地协作。

1. 遵循命名约定

在C++中,每个程序员都应该遵循命名约定。使用一致的命名风格,可以使开发人员更容易地阅读和理解代码。

2. 使用有意义的名称

类名应该精确地描述它们所代表的对象或概念。使用有意义的名称使程序员更容易理解代码所做的工作。

3. 使用大驼峰命名法

在C++中,类名通常使用大驼峰命名法(也称为帕斯卡命名法)。这意味着每个单词的首字母都大写,但单词之间没有下划线。

例如,一个类名为"CarModel"。注意,在C++中,类名的第一个字母通常也是大写的,以与其他标识符进行区分。

4. 使用指示性前缀

为了方便阅读,可以使用指示性前缀来表明一个类的类型。例如,可以在类名前面加上代表类型的字母,如"C"表示类,"I"表示接口,"S"表示静态类等。

5. 避免使用保留字

C++有一些保留字不能用来作为类名,如"throw"和"new"等。避免使用这些保留字作为类名,以确保代码能够编译。

6. 符合命名空间规则

在命名空间中,类名应该遵循命名空间规则。这意味着它们应该以命名空间的名称作为前缀,并用两个冒号分隔。例如,命名空间名为"MyNamespace",一个类名为"MyNamespace::CarModel"。

总之,良好的类名命名规则是程序员在编写C++代码时应该遵循的标准。它确保代码的可读性和可维护性,并减少了开发过程中的混乱程度。遵循这些规则可以使你编写更好的代码,并在团队开发中更好地协作。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复
    相似文章